Job Summary:
We are seeking a passionate and dedicated Toddler Teacher to join our team. As a Toddler Teacher, you will be responsible for creating a nurturing and stimulating environment where young children can learn and grow. Your role will involve planning and implementing age-appropriate activities, fostering social and emotional development, and promoting a love for learning.
Duties:
- Develop and implement lesson plans that align with the curriculum and educational goals
- Create a safe and inclusive classroom environment for children to explore, play, and learn
- Provide individualized attention and support to each child's unique needs
- Foster social skills, emotional development, and positive behavior through effective classroom management techniques
- Collaborate with parents or guardians to ensure open communication and involvement in their child's education
- Assess student progress through observation, assessment tools, and regular evaluations
- Maintain accurate records of student attendance, progress, and development
- Collaborate with other teachers and staff members to create a cohesive learning community
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Early Childhood Education or related field preferred
- Previous experience working with toddlers in a classroom setting
- Knowledge of child development principles and age-appropriate teaching methods
- Familiarity with early childhood education curriculum frameworks
- Strong communication skills to effectively interact with children, parents, and colleagues
- Patience, creativity, and enthusiasm for working with young children
- Ability to adapt teaching strategies to meet the diverse needs of students
